Fuel bi “when the declaration” is simple to make usage of inside the DAX. It really works like in the event the-more during the SQL. The sentence structure out of if report when you look at the dax is
Should your returns of your analytical_attempt holds true, this may be screens the following factor, just in case it’s not the case, upcoming view the 3rd parameter.
It is important to remember that each other worth_if_true and value_if_not true have to have a similar data types of; if you don’t, it will toss a blunder.
You can find new student “marks” dining table with different articles. We strive to produce you to custom line called “Groups” to the adopting the dax phrase.
DAX nested if declaration when you look at the Fuel BI
Let us go on to the power bi nested in the event that statement implementation. We will see a similar research table that you have viewed significantly more than.
Within dax algorithm, i’ve utilized a couple of when the comments. Very first, the audience is contrasting if your obtained scratches column has actually a respect out-of lower than 60. It does go back amount C. Should your criteria get back false, then our company is creating again an additional in the event that report that assesses if “acquired scratching” is lower than 70, then it shows level B if you don’t values Good as you can see lower than.
While we had mentioned before, the data type of “true” and you may “false” regarding in the event that statement ought to be the exact same; if not, it can toss a blunder.
Today in this algorithm, i have other investigation designs (text message and you can integer) getting “true” and “false” opinions. We will have the following error
If report with logical workers when you look at the DAX
Which formula states in the event your “Acquired scratching” was more than 65 and you can victims is equivalent to “Computer”, “Math” or “Physics” it will teach “CS Group” or even it can let you know “Low CS Group”.
We can have fun with a two fold tubing agent otherwise “OR” driver on the if the declaration. We have a constraint once we fool around with “Otherwise user.”
So it algorithm often produce a blunder “Unnecessary arguments was in fact enacted towards Otherwise means. Maximum argument matter into means is dos.” Towards Otherwise mode, we can simply admission a few details, however, if we require over a few criteria, up coming we should instead use a dual pipe driver while the less than.
Stamina BI button setting when you look at the dax
The first factor of your switch form was an expression. You could potentially render a term that may generate scalar worth.
The next factor is actually a beneficial “effects.” Should your “value” factor is matched up into the outcome of an expression, then it displays the fresh new “result” if you don’t, it is some other fits or perhaps in the fresh new more area.
I have offered victims because a term into key function. Next, we have been checking the prices on subject line. If your well worth is equal to “Physics,” this may be tend to display screen “Py.” In the sense, it can row because of the line and view switch form for every single subject. If the no topic fits, then it is certainly going about more area and you can screen “Unkown.”
Switch mode during the DAX having Correct()
Let us build key function more complex. We are able to establish an effective dax formula to display scratching having computer system and you can math. The latest standards is actually if the niche is mathematics and display its obtained scratches as it. Should your topic was a computer, next basic, they monitors in the event your midterm scratches into the computer system is actually better than simply fifteen following displays their received scratches.
Right here i’ve given the original parameter is actually “True().” It means, in any case, the first expression is true, plus it is true of checking numerous requirements.
The good thing are we are able to blend criteria playing with various other workers, and in the effect factor, we are able to play with one line otherwise measure.
if the declaration from inside the size strength bi
People struggling to fool around with in the event that report in dax measures. It’s very easy to use if the report inside the dax strength bi steps.
Why don’t we fool around with countif to track down people subjects for every student in which acquired scratching each subject are higher than 60.
Right here you will find put countx form and you will violation the first factor because a filter means. This filter mode usually come back a dining table in which acquired marks are greater than sixty. Countx means often iterate a desk that is returned of the filter function and implement relying on the subject line.
Eventually, we shall pull college students as well as the “Subject matter” size towards statement, clearly lower than.
Now we need further drill down and try to score ladies people only. We truly need the female college students having those people sufferers in which received marks was more than 60.
You will find provided [Topic number] scale while the a phrase to help you assess means and you will Student intercourse = “F” as the a filtration. This may provide us with “topic amount” just for lady youngsters, as you can tell less than.
You will find considering requirements so you can if be the “subject count” level. If the subject matter try higher than 3, this may be tend to go back some other measure titled “Females students” if you don’t, it will go back a blank.